Course Content

• Introduction to Soil Microbial Ecology and Diversity
• Soilborne Pathogen Identification and Characterization (including *Phytophthora*, *Fusarium*, *Rhizoctonia*)
• Soil Health Assessment and Diagnostics: Microbial Indicators
• Sustainable Soil Management Practices for Disease Prevention
• Biocontrol Agents and their Applications in Soilborne Disease Management
• Molecular Techniques in Soil Microbial Diversity Analysis (e.g., 16S rRNA gene sequencing)
• Soilborne Disease Prevention Strategies: Integrated Pest Management (IPM)
• Advanced Topics in Soil Microbial Interactions and their implications for Soilborne Diseases
• Case Studies in Soilborne Disease Management and Soil Microbial Diversity
